Global Water-based Medical Adhesives Market Size (2023-2030)

In 2022, the Global Water-based Medical Adhesives Market was valued at $4.23 billion, and is projected to reach a market size of $6.14 billion by 2030. Over the forecast period of 2023-2030, market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 4.77%.

Water-based Medical Adhesives Market

Water is the primary solvent in the specialized adhesives known as "water-based medical adhesives," which are used in numerous medical applications. These adhesives, which were made specifically to adhere to biological tissues, have reliable bonding and sealing capabilities. Operations, wound healing, and the creation of medical devices all frequently involve their use. Medical adhesives made of water have several advantages over those made of traditional solvents. Their biocompatibility, lack of toxicity, and low volatility make them less likely to damage tissue or have negative effects. Furthermore, the exceptional flexibility of these adhesives permits normal tissue movement without weakening the bond. Water, polymer components, cross-linking agents, and other additives are frequently added during the formulation process to improve the adhesive properties of water-based medical adhesives. They can be easily spread or sprayed onto the desired area because they are typically applied in liquid form. After being used, the adhesive goes through a curing process in which the water is expelled, leaving behind a solid and long-lasting bond. Medical applications such as tissue engineering, drug delivery systems, incision sealing, and wound closure all rely heavily on water-based medical adhesives. Global Water-based Medical Adhesives Market Challenges:

The existence of strict regulatory standards is one of the biggest obstacles facing the global market for water-based medical adhesives. Medical adhesives used in healthcare settings must adhere to several rules and specifications, consisting of ISO 10993 (Biomedical Standard) for bio-compatibility. Manufacturers must comply with specific requirements relating to safety, efficacy, and quality control under these regulations. It can take a lot of testing and documentation to comply with these standards, which can be a challenging and time-consuming process. Water-based medical adhesives are more expensive to produce overall due to the strict regulatory environment, and manufacturers face difficulties in maintaining both competitive pricing and regulatory compliance.

Global Water-based Medical Adhesives Market Recent Developments:

In August 2021, Baxter International Inc. completed the acquisition of some assets from CryoLife, Inc. for the PerClot Polysaccharide Hemostatic System. The acquisition broadens Baxter's selection of products for advanced surgery and is estimated to be worth up to $60.8 million. Baxter put down a $25 million deposit and will add to it once certain goals are met. PerClot, a global product sold in more than 35 nations, is not yet available for purchase in the United States.
